What Are Web 2.0 Backlinks?
Web 2.0 backlinks come from user-generated platforms like blogging sites, social media, forums, and online communities. These platforms allow users to create content and place links to their websites. Some popular Web 2.0 platforms include WordPress, Blogger, Medium, Tumblr, and Weebly.
These backlinks work by linking a website to high-authority domains, signaling to search engines that the content is valuable and trustworthy.

How to Create High-Quality Web 2.0 Backlinks
Choose Reliable Web 2.0 Platforms
Select trusted and high-authority platforms like Medium, Blogger, and WordPress. These sites provide a strong foundation for safe and effective backlinking.
Create Unique and Valuable Content
Web 2.0 backlinks work best when high-quality, original content is used. Writing informative articles, blog posts, and guides increases engagement and makes the links more effective.
Use Anchor Text Strategically
Anchor text should be relevant and natural. Instead of using generic phrases like "click here," choose keywords that describe the linked page, helping with SEO optimization.
Add Multimedia Elements
Using images, videos, and infographics makes Web 2.0 content more appealing and shareable. This improves engagement and increases the chances of backlinks being indexed by search engines.
Update Content Regularly
Keeping Web 2.0 blogs active and updated signals search engines that the content is fresh and relevant, further strengthening backlink authority.
